What are the responsibilities and job description for the Brick and Masonry Repairs Technician position at Allegheny Restoration Inc.?
Seeking applicant for general labor, brick and concrete repairs. Work would include operating electric chipping hammers, grinders, cement mixing tools, caulking replacement, cement placing and finishing, installation of brick and stone, replacement of mortar joints and wall/floor coatings. Tasks described above can be completed at ground level from scaffolding or elevated working platforms such as swing stages and boom lifts. Workers are required to hold a current driver's license and provide own transportation to and from work. Employees are required to complete yearly criminal background checks and clearances to work at school/university campuses and government offices. OSHA 10 Certification is required. Workers will frequently be assigned projects working away from home Monday - Thursday, however local job opportunities do occur. Employer compensates for time spent out of town, including housing and travel pay. Starting pay for basic labor is $20.00 an hour and increases with experience.
